Job Description – Asian Commis (Commis I / II / III)Position Summary
The Asian Commis is responsible for assisting in the preparation, cooking, and presentation of authentic Asian cuisine while maintaining the highest standards of food quality, hygiene, and kitchen safety. The role supports the Chef de Partie and Sous Chef in ensuring smooth day-to-day kitchen operations.
Key Responsibilities
- Prepare and cook Asian dishes as per standardized recipes and portion specifications.
- Assist in the preparation of mise en place before service.
- Maintain consistency in taste, quality, and presentation of all dishes.
- Ensure all food preparation is completed within the required timelines.
- Follow food safety, hygiene, and sanitation standards at all times.
- Maintain cleanliness of workstations, kitchen equipment, and storage areas.
- Monitor stock levels and report shortages to the Chef de Partie.
- Store and label food items correctly following FIFO and FEFO procedures.
- Minimize food wastage and ensure efficient utilization of ingredients.
- Assist in receiving, checking, and storing kitchen supplies.
- Follow kitchen SOPs, recipes, and quality standards.
- Work effectively with the kitchen team during busy service periods.
- Comply with all company policies, safety regulations, and grooming standards.

Experience
- Commis III: 0–1 year of experience in an Asian kitchen.
- Commis II: 1–2 years of relevant experience.
- Commis I: 2–4 years of experience in Asian cuisine in hotels or restaurants.
